A "repack" is a version of the game where the files have been heavily compressed to reduce the download size. While the original FIFA 18 can exceed 40GB or 50GB (depending on DLC), a high-compression repack can reduce this significantly. However, unlike the original version, a repack must be "installed" or decompressed on your PC before playing, which requires a strong CPU and can take several hours.
